Floyd Central and New Albany squared off in some playoff action on Friday, but Floyd Central had to settle for second. They received a blow as they fell 70-54 to the New Albany Bulldogs. The loss continues a trend for the Highlanders in their meetings with the Bulldogs: they've now lost five in a row.

Floyd Central's loss came despite strong showings from Landon Reed and Sam Higgins. Reed went 5-for-12 en route to 22 points, while Higgins shot 70% from the field to rack up 22 points. That was a full 40.7% of Floyd Central's points, marking the fourth time in a row Reed has posted more than a third of the team's points.

Floyd Central's defeat dropped their record down to 5-19. As for New Albany, the win was the fourth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 19-4.

Floyd Central does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for New Albany, they have already played their next game, a 62-47 loss against Jeffersonville on the 8th.
